Today’s roster move: The Cubs have optioned Javier Assad back to Triple-A Iowa and recalled Jordan Wicks. This would indicate to me that the team thinks Cade Horton is 100 percent, and the rotation thus is Horton, Matthew Boyd, Jameson Taillon, Shōta Imanaga and Colin Rea — for now, at least. Wicks likely works out of the bullpen — for now, at least.
Cade Horton, RHP vs. Victor Mederos, RHP
Cade Horton left his last start with a blister, but after the game pronounced himself good to go for this one, so here we are.
Even with that shortened outing, Horton has an ERA of 0.58 and a WHIP of 0.806 over his last six starts, with 27 strikeouts and only one home run allowed in 31 innings. That’s really good!
Hopefully he’s 100 percent tonight. Horton has obviously never faced the Angels or anyone on their active roster.
Victor Mederos has made 11 appearances (two starts) in several stints with the Angels over the last three seasons. This year he made one relief appearance in April, one in July and then was recalled this month from Triple-A and has made two starts, allowing three runs and a home run in each of them.
He’s never faced the Cubs, but Carson Kelly and Justin Turner each have one plate appearance against him, for whatever that’s worth.
